Earlier Report Observations

The market volume for chocolate and cocoa products in Eastern Europe grew from 1.3 million tonnes in 2018 to 1.44 million tonnes in 2023. This expansion was initially driven by a sharp increase in domestic production, with output rising over 50% year-on-year, indicating new players entering the market and significant capacity expansion. Consumer perception of chocolate as a healthy treat due to high cocoa content supported steady sales growth throughout the period.

In value terms, the market surged from $7.0 billion to $9.8 billion, with notable jumps in 2021 and 2023. Starting in 2022, crop failures in West Africa disrupted cocoa bean supplies, pushing up raw material costs. Combined with a weakening ruble, this led to higher chocolate prices. Producers adapted by reducing cocoa content, using substitute fats, and cutting portion sizes, while segments like white chocolate and cocoa-free confectionery gained popularity.

The market's structure evolved with the emergence of new segments, including those with high cocoa content. Simultaneously, rising costs prompted a shift toward cocoa-free alternatives, which grew 10-15% in 2023, reflecting changing consumption patterns under sustained price inflation and revived domestic demand.

After two years of growth, chocolate and cocoa products production in Eastern Europe (including Northern Asia) declined. In 2020, the region produced 1 463.8 K t, showing a slight decrease of 1.1% compared to 2019. Over the 2017-2020 period, production rose by 8.2%, with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 2.7%. The highest production level was recorded in 2019 at 1 480.1 K t, while the largest annual increase occurred in 2018 at 4.8%.

Chocolate and cocoa products production value in Eastern Europe (including Northern Asia) increased for the third consecutive year. In 2020, output was valued at 7 838 M $ US, reflecting a slight rise of 1.0% from 2019. From 2017 to 2020, production value grew by 7.2%, equivalent to an annualized rate of 2.4%.

Exports chocolate and cocoa products from Eastern Europe (including Northern Asia)

Exports in kind, K t

Chocolate and cocoa products exports from Eastern Europe (including Northern Asia) increased for the third year in a row. In 2020, exports totaled 781.9 K t, representing a controlled uptick of 6.2% compared to 2019. Over the 2017-2020 period, exports grew by 31.6%, with a CAGR of 9.6%.

From 2017 to 2020, chocolate and cocoa products from Eastern Europe (including Northern Asia) were traded with numerous countries. The top destinations—the United Kingdom, Germany, and Kazakhstan—together accounted for only 25.8% of total exports in volume terms, indicating a diversified export market.

Imports chocolate and cocoa products to Eastern Europe (including Northern Asia)

Imports in kind, K t

In 2020, chocolate and cocoa products imports into Eastern Europe (including Northern Asia) stood at 625.2 K t, showing a strong increase of 12.0% compared to 2019. Between 2017 and 2020, imports grew by 19%, equating to an annualized rate of 6.0%. The largest decline was recorded in 2019 at 0.7%.

From 2017 to 2020, Germany (29.0% of imports in volume), Belgium (6.5%), and Italy (6.4%) were the largest suppliers of chocolate and cocoa products to Eastern Europe (including Northern Asia). However, their combined contribution was limited to 41.9% of total imports, highlighting a diversified import structure.
